Staff Software Engineer - Storage
Company
Location
USA
Type
Full Time
Job Description
The position is a blend of software engineering and systems engineering with a strong focus on building and evolving control and data planes improving underlying systems and writing software that implements critical workflows to automate and enhance the operation of our large-scale storage infrastructure.
We also work with our product teams to make the underlying Storage technologies work better for Reddit’s main workloads including defining and improving the application’s data models and data access patterns and lots of times this also involves data-driven analysis and tuning of the Storage stack to make step function improvements to the end-to-end data path. There is a substantial amount of troubleshooting and analysis to understand the real problems we face as we scale and our customer’s workloads change.
A successful candidate will;
-
Design write and deliver software to improve the availability scalability latency and efficiency of Reddit’s products in Go C++ and sometimes Python.
-
Dive deep into the codebase of supported storage systems to understand system internals.
-
Be able to make system level improvements enhancements and implement complex code modifications.
-
Engage actively with the open-source community to implement and upstream changes to the OSS codebase.
-
Contribute to the design and implementation of high-performance large-scale distributed storage systems to power various use cases at Reddit.
-
Collaborate closely with engineering teams and stakeholders to integrate storage capabilities into broader storage infrastructure and use cases across Reddit.
-
Mentor and guide other engineers on how to design build and evangelize vector storage services across Reddit
Who You Might Be:
-
7+ years of experience building internet-scale software preferably with a focus on machine learning storage infrastructure.
-
Software development experience in one or more general purpose programming languages; Golang Python C++ Java
-
Hands-on experience implementing features optimizations and bug fixes to distributed storage systems.
-
Experience contributing code improvements features and bug fixes to open-source (OSS) projects.
-
Prior experience with operating a large scale critical infrastructure system with a focus on automation and workflow development is a plus especially in a role where they were required to be on call.
-
Excellent communication skills to collaborate with a service-oriented team and company.
Benefits:
-
Comprehensive Healthcare Benefits and Income Replacement Programs
-
401k Match
-
Family Planning Support
-
Gender-Affirming Care
-
Mental Health & Coaching Benefits
-
Flexible Vacation & Reddit Global Days off
-
Generous paid Parental Leave
-
Paid Volunteer time off
#LI-remote #LI-JS5
Pay Transparency:
This job posting may span more than one career level.
In addition to base salary this job is eligible to receive equity in the form of restricted stock units and depending on the position offered it may also be eligible to receive a commission. Additionally Reddit offers a wide range of benefits to U.S.-based employees including medical dental and vision insurance 401(k) program with employer match generous time off for vacation and parental leave. To learn more please visit https://www.redditinc.com/careers/ .
To provide greater transparency to candidates we share base pay ranges for all US-based job postings regardless of state. We set standard base pay ranges for all roles based on function level and country location benchmarked against similar stage growth companies. Final offer amounts are determined by multiple factors including skills depth of work experience and relevant licenses/credentials and may vary from the amounts listed below.
The base pay range for this position is:
$217000—$303900 USD
Date Posted
12/17/2025
Views
0
Similar Jobs
Staff Salesforce Engineer - CRM Systems - GitLab
Views in the last 30 days - 0
This job description outlines a Staff Salesforce Developer role focusing on designing building and scaling enterprisegrade solutions across Salesforce...
View DetailsSoftware Engineer III | Platform - ExtraHop
Views in the last 30 days - 0
This job posting seeks a Software Engineer III to develop features lead junior team members and contribute to secure cloud and appliance solutions The...
View DetailsEngineering Manager - Software Supply Chain Security: Auth Infrastructure - GitLab
Views in the last 30 days - 0
This job description highlights a leadership role in developing secure scalable authentication infrastructure for GitLab It emphasizes technical exper...
View DetailsDevOps Engineer - Guidehouse
Views in the last 30 days - 0
This job posting seeks a skilled DevOps Engineer to support development QA and operations across applications emphasizing automation cloudnative infra...
View DetailsSoftware Solutions Architect - Unqork
Views in the last 30 days - 0
Unqork empowers enterprises with AIpowered applications emphasizing innovation security and growth The job posting highlights benefits like remote wor...
View DetailsGrowth Product Lead - Loyalty - Trafilea
Views in the last 30 days - 0
Trafilea promotes itself as a transformative consumer tech platform with AIdriven growth solutions highlighting achievements like 1B revenue and globa...
View Details